Windows Live® Search Results Admiral (Arabic, amir al, “lord of the”), in common usage, a naval officer of the highest rank, also referred to as a flag officer. A system of gradations in the rank of admiral prevails in all major navies of the world. In the British navy, except for the substitution of the title Admiral of the Fleet for that of Fleet Admiral, the grades are identical to those of the United States Navy. Admiral ranks with a general in the army. Rank insignia for British and American admirals are a broad gold stripe around the lower sleeve with one or more narrower stripes above it. Horatio Nelson was Britain's best-known admiral, who defeated the French and Spanish at Trafalgar in 1805, establishing Britain's domination of the seas for the rest of the century.
